#9d0a52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d0a52 is composed of 61.6% red, 3.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 47.8%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 330.6 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 32.7%. #9d0a52 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ff14a4 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#9d0a52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d0a52 has RGB values of R:157, G:10,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.48,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10291794.

Shades and Tints of #9d0a52
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090105 is the darkest color, while #fef6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d0a52
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565153 is the less saturated color, while #a30452 is the most saturated one.
